Erie, PA vs Winchester, VA
Cost of Living Comparison
Erie, PA is more affordable by 5.5 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Erie, PA | Winchester, VA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 91.0 | 96.5 | -5.5 |
| Housing | 56.8 | 90.0 | -33.2 |
| Goods | 100.7 | 96.7 | +4.0 |
| Utilities | 106.8 | 89.7 | +17.1 |
| Other Services | 97.7 | 98.8 | -1.1 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Erie, PA | Winchester, VA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$59,396 | $79,416 |
| Median Home Value | $160,200 | $301,100 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$851 | $1,246 |
| Per Capita Income | $32,858 | $39,552 |
